Jan is an open-source AI tool that allows users to run models locally, ensuring privacy and data ownership.

Choose from open models or plug in your favorite online models
Jan allows users to select from a variety of open models or integrate their preferred online models. This flexibility enables users to customize their AI experience based on their specific needs and preferences.
Jan-Code-4B
This model is designed for coding tasks and is part of Jan's suite of foundation models. It provides users with advanced capabilities for programming-related queries and tasks, enhancing productivity and efficiency.
Jan-v3-4B
Jan-v3-4B is a versatile model that supports a wide range of tasks, including conversational AI and information retrieval. It is built to provide accurate and contextually relevant responses, making it suitable for various applications.
Jan-v2-VL
This model is optimized for visual language tasks, allowing users to engage with both text and images. It enhances the interaction experience by providing context-aware responses based on visual inputs.
Jan-v1
Jan-v1 serves as the foundational model for various applications within the Jan ecosystem. It is designed to handle a broad spectrum of queries and tasks, ensuring a robust user experience.
Jan Nano 128k
This lightweight model is tailored for quick responses and efficient processing. It is ideal for users who require fast interactions without compromising on quality.
Jan Nano 32k
Similar to the 128k variant, Jan Nano 32k is designed for rapid processing and response times. It caters to users looking for efficiency in their AI interactions.
Lucy
Lucy is a specialized model within the Jan ecosystem, focusing on specific tasks or domains. It enhances the overall functionality of Jan by providing targeted capabilities.

Autonomous AI agents
Jan features autonomous AI agents that can perform tasks on behalf of the user, such as reading files and managing calendars. These agents can interact through platforms like WhatsApp, Discord, or Slack, providing seamless integration into users' workflows.
Real-time web search
Jan offers real-time web search capabilities, allowing users to access up-to-date information directly within the application. This feature enhances the relevance and accuracy of responses, making it a powerful tool for research and inquiry.
Memory feature (Coming Soon)
Jan will soon include a memory feature that retains user context and preferences across sessions. This capability will allow for more personalized interactions, as Jan will remember past conversations and user-specific details.
Open-source and local deployment
Jan is an open-source tool that can be deployed locally on users' machines. This ensures that users maintain full control over their data and interactions, enhancing privacy and security.
No API bills
By running Jan locally, users avoid incurring API costs associated with cloud-based AI services. This feature makes Jan a cost-effective solution for individuals and organizations looking to leverage AI technology.
Your data stays with you
Jan ensures that all user data remains on the user's device, providing a high level of privacy. This feature is crucial for users concerned about data security and the potential risks of cloud storage.
